Target group

Applicants who want to engage both practically and theoretically with media and new digital technologies and stories from areas such as storytelling, film, games, journalism, etc. Applicants must have a BA degree or an equivalent or higher academic degree and at least one year of specialised professional experience or similar professional project experience.

Annotation

The Master´s degree programme in DIGITAL NARRATIVES is organised as part of a cooperation agreement with the TH Cologne at the ifs Internationale Filmschule Köln (international film school). The degree course commences every other year in the winter semester. Next commencement in the winter semester 2026/2027. Admission requirements

A Bachelor's degree with proof of at least 180 ECTS (or a comparable academic degree or higher degree). To ensure that educational certificates and degrees obtained abroad meet the admission requirements of the ifs (university qualifications), applicants can consult the following database: http://anabin.kmk.org. At least one year of specialised professional experience or comparable professional project experience after the Bachelor's academic degree. In justified exceptional cases, applicants with exceptional artistic skills who lack one or more of these formal requirements in their CV may be admitted to the degree course as further education participants. Very good proficiency in English

More information regarding tuition fees

Tuition fee for "non-EU citizens": EUR 3,750 per semester Tuition fee for "EU citizens": EUR 2,750 per semester One-time enrolment fee for "all students": EUR 400 Semester contribution H Köln (Cologne University of Applied Sciences) for "all students": approx. EUR 300
